Beskrivelse
This first major gathering of the younger poets of Hungary witnesses to the
poetics of a new post-1989 Europe. The poetics are still in the making but
important poets appear and develop. They are writers whose mature work has
been produced in the new social, psychological and political circumstances and
they include major women poets such as Anna T. Szab , and Krisztina T th as
well as highly acclaimed figures like J nos T rey and Andr s Gerevich.
The translators are chiefly poets of the same generation - Owen Sheers, Antony
Dunn, Clare Pollard, Matthew Hollis and gnes Leh czky, whose work sits
alongside writers long associated with the translation of Hungarian poetry:
George G m ri, Clive Wilmer, Peter Zollman and the editor, George Szirtes.
